1. Avocados

A green superfood, avocados are rich in dietary fiber, (beneficial) mono-unsaturated fatty acids, phytochemical (biologically active compounds that are found in plants), and potassium.

Incorporating avocados into your daily diet can help you achieve a lower BMI (Body Mass Index). Women who eat avocados on a regular basis tend to lose weight and notice a reduction in waist circumference.

Even though avocados are higher in calories in comparison to several other fruits and vegetables, it’s their fat-fiber combo that can help you shed some pounds. Women who eat avocados also tend to consume significantly less amount of added sugar in comparison to those who do not.

2. Berries

Berries are among the best sources of fiber that have been known to help in weight management. For each gram of fiber you consume, you will be eliminating almost seven calories!

Just one cup of blackberries or raspberries will provide you with roughly eight grams of fiber.

Strawberries are known to reduce blood sugar and insulin levels after having meals. Researchers believe that an antioxidant present in strawberries effectively blocks an enzyme that breaks starch into sugar.

This in turn means reduced simple sugar flow into the bloodstream and hence lower blood sugar levels and corresponding insulin response.

Reduced insulin level aids weight loss as insulin plays a key role in the transformation of sugar into fat.

Recent animal studies have shown that ‘raspberry ketones’ (a natural substance) help in preventing fat buildup in the body. Consuming raspberries on a regular basis may help in reducing the belly fat which is considered to be the most dangerous as it can increase the risk of type-2 diabetes, heart diseases, and cancer.

Blueberries are also known to help reduce belly fat.

3. Almonds/Nuts  

A rich source of both fiber and protein, almonds can make you feel fuller for a long duration of time. In other words, you will feel less tempted to snack on unhealthy foods.

Almonds are also rich in Vitamin E and heart-friendly mono-and-poly-unsaturated fats.

A recent study performed on overweight women found that participants who consumed around 50 grams of almonds in their daily weight-loss diet achieved significantly better weight-loss results in three months.

Women who consumed almonds also registered a decrease in their waist size, cholesterol, BMI, and blood sugar level.

A large-scale study in Europe compared nut intake and five-year changes in body weight in 2017. The study revealed that the participants who consumed nuts gained much less weight than those who did not, over the duration of five years.

4. Popcorn

Not many women know that eating popcorn – 100% natural whole grain – may also help with weight loss.

This famous crunchy treat is low in calories, high in fiber, and has a lower energy density than many other snacks. These are some of the main characteristics of weight-loss-friendly food.

One-ounce serving will provide you with around four grams of fiber, four grams of protein, and 110 calories.

Air-popped popcorn is also considered an excellent snack for women who want to lose weight as it fills you up faster. Eating air-popped popcorn also takes longer. So, you remain occupied for an extended duration of time, without consuming too many calories.

A relevant study, published in the famous Nutrition Journal revealed that popcorn was significantly more satiating than potato chips.

Do keep in mind that popcorn sold at movie theaters is generally high in sodium and fat. So, you should avoid popcorn if you are going to the movies.

5. Oatmeal

You can start your day with a bowl of oatmeal to achieve your weight-loss goals faster. With a punch of fiber and numerous nutrients, you will feel fuller during the day and consumer fewer unhealthy snacks.

Besides being a weight-loss-friendly food, oats offer a wide range of additional benefits as well. It’s because oats are a great source of fiber, carbohydrates, antioxidants, vitamins, and minerals. They also contain more fat and protein than most other grains.

Oats are rich in beta-glucan, a type of soluble fiber.

This fiber forms a gel-like solution in the gut. Numerous health benefits of including oats in your daily diet include heightened feeling of fullness, reduction in blood sugar level and corresponding insulation response, reduction in cholesterol level, and increase in the growth of beneficial bacteria in the digestive tract.

6.  Eggs

A popular breakfast ingredient, eggs can keep you from eating more during the next meal. Eggs are rich in protein and low in calories. Some scientific evidence also suggests that eggs may help improve metabolism as well.

Protein provided by eggs aids weight loss as its highly filling. Just one egg can provide you with around six grams of protein.

People, who frequently eat eggs, report feeling less hungry for at least three hours. Reducing carbohydrate intake is one of the best ways to lose weight and incorporating eggs in one or more meals (e.g. lunch and dinner) can help you do exactly that.

Eating eggs in breakfast can also have a positive effect on blood sugar and insulin levels.

7. Pulses and Vegetables

Pulses such as beans, lentils, chickpeas, peas, etc. and cruciferous vegetables such as cabbage, Brussels sprouts, cauliflower, broccoli, etc. contain fiber and can help you manage the body weight.

Researchers have shown that weight-loss diets that included pulses show better weight-loss results than those that did not.

The manner in which pulses and vegetables help you lose weight is similar to that of oatmeal. Soluble fibers present in these foods help slow down the digestion process and absorption. Proteins supplied by pulses also make you feel fuller for a long duration of time.

8. Salmon 

Fatty fish such as salmon can keep you full for an extended duration of time. 

Rich in healthy fats, proteins, and other nutrients, fish – and seafood in general also provides you with iodine.

It is an important nutrient that helps regulate the thyroid function, which in turn leads to optimal metabolic function. 

Rich in omega-3 fatty acids, salmon can also help reduce the possibility of inflammation, which according to the latest research available, plays a role in obesity. 

9. Boiled Potatoes 

Boiled potatoes can provide you with small quantities of a wide range of nutrients. Potatoes are rich in potassium, which indirectly helps regulate blood pressure.

In one study, white boiled potatoes recorded the highest Satiety Index among all foods studied. It means that boiled potatoes can help you resist the urge to snack on unhealthy foods, thereby aid in weight loss. 

A high concentration of resistant starch in cooled down potatoes is also believed to aid in weight loss. 

10. Soup 

You are likely to consume fewer calories on a daily basis if you eat meals with relatively lower energy density.

This is exactly what happens when you include soups in your daily diet. 

Studies have revealed that when you eat solid foods in the form of soups, it not only makes you feel fuller but you also consume fewer calories.
